- Good Morning Frends😌 It’s another episode of FRUITY FACTS🔥 Today, we are discussing WATERMELONS 🍉🍉🍉
DID YOU KNOW?⁉️⁉️
* Watermelons, hence their name, are made up of 92% water
* Watermelon is one of the only foods to be classified as both a fruit and a vegetable
* Watermelon is a relative of pumpkins and cucumbers
* Early explorers used watermelons similar to a drink bottle to hold fluids
* Watermelon is grown in 96 countries
* Watermelon has a greater concentrated source of lycopene in comparison to tomatoes
* There are more than 1,200 varieties of different watermelons
* Although many people prefer not to, all of the watermelon including the rind can be eaten
* There is evidence showing that the first watermelon ever grown was in Egypt approximately 5,000 years ago
* Watermelon juice may relieve muscle tension
* Watermelon is rich in many vitamins and contains 6% sugar. has only about 40 calories per cup.
* The heaviest watermelon recorded weighed 350.5 lbs and was grown in 2013
* Seedless watermelons are not genetically modified but are a hybrid species

- Hello Frends😌❤️ On today’s episode of FRUITY FACTS⁉️ we will be discussing APPLES🍎🍎
DID YOU KNOW🫵⁉️
1. Apple trees take 4-5 years to produce their first fruit. A standard size apple tree starts bearing fruit 8-10 years after it is planted. A dwarf tree starts bearing fruit in 3-5 years.
2. Apples will ripen six to ten times faster at room temperature than if they were refrigerated.
3. There are more than 2,500 varieties of apples and they come in all shades of red, green and yellow.
4. The science of apple growing is called pomology.
5. 25% of an apples volume is air, which is why they float in liquid.
6. Most apple blossoms are pink when they open but gradually transform into white.
7. It takes the energy of 50 leaves to produce one apple.
8. Apples come in all sizes from just a bit bigger than a cherry to about the same size as a grapefruit.
9. Most apples are still picked by hand.
10. Apples contain 0 grams of fat or sodium and have no cholesterol
11. Apples are excellent source of fiber and they help improve your memory, mental alertness, and electrical activity of the brain.

Today! We will be discussing LIMES😌
1. Organic limes have no wax on the peel and therefore are perfect for drinks and recipes
2. Limes are native to India.
3. Lime juice is used in cooking and in drinks and it’s oils are often used in perfumes and cosmetics.
4. Limes sinks in liquid whereas lemons floats😲.
5. Limes are rich in potassium.
6. Limes contain Vitamin C, which helps to combat scurvy.
7. One lime tree can produce over 1000 fruits annually!
8. The bigger the leaves the smaller the limes, wow!
9. Limes constantly mutate with other species.
10. Some species of lime are actually yellow when ripe.
